GRAY JOINS MODESTO POLICE AND FIRE TO CELEBRATE NEARLY $2 MILLION IN FEDERAL FUNDING SECURED FOR DEPARTMENTS

Last week, Congressman Adam Gray (CA-13) joined members of the Modesto Police and Fire Departments to celebrate nearly $2 million dollars in federal funding he secured for improvement projects.

The funding for these projects was secured by Congressman Gray as part of the 2026 Community Project Funding process. Under House Appropriations Committee guidelines, each Representative was able to request funding for up to 15 projects for Fiscal Year 2026. Projects are restricted to applicable federal funding streams and only state and local governments and eligible nonprofits were permitted to receive funding.

"One of my top priorities in Congress is bringing back federal funding to the Valley," said Congressman Adam Gray. "This nearly $2 million dollars in community project funding that we secured will help ensure that the Modesto Police Department and the Modesto Fire Department can make the necessary infrastructure improvements needed to keep the Valley safe and prepared to respond to emergencies."

During his visit to the Police Department, Congressman Gray met with Chief Brandon Gillespie and Modesto law enforcement officials to see how more than $1 million dollars in federal funding he secured for cutting-edge technology upgrades will help keep the Valley safe.

At Station 1 in downtown Modesto, Congressman Gray did a walkthrough with Chief Shanon Evans to see firsthand how $850,000 in federal funding he secured will be used for the rehabilitation and improvement of the station.
